Biblical Theology of Sexuality: Introduction

Recently a request was made for an appropriate Christian response to homosexuality. While I wanted to just fire off an answer, I quickly realized that my response to homosexuality is contigent upon my Biblical theological understanding of sexuality. Thus, in order to give an adequate response, that is, to avoid the common cliches and unfounded claims, I'd have to show my work. After all, this blog isn't here for me to indoctrinate the readers on my say-so; if there is any indoctrination, let it rest directly and visibly upon the Word.

That said, I'm going to be starting a series on a Biblical theology of sexuality, the focus of which, I believe, is the marriage covenant. Call that last part my thesis, I guess. This will bring out a response to issues of all sorts, including the proposed response to homosexuality. I've got a few other topics to address as well.
